I Killed my 4R70W, opinions on how I did it?
I've lost Drive and OD on our 2000 5.0 Explorer. 1 and 2 still work as well as Reverse. Just as the trans is about to shift into D it "neutrals". It never makes it to OD. If I turn off the OD it will hold 2nd, seemingly indefinitely; if OD is on it will neutral. It may be coincidence, but I think the event I'll describe was related to the failure, and hope that someone can explain what happened in technical terms. Driving about 45 mph the car stalled. I put it in Neutral and restarted it, didn't slow the vehicle, and put it back in Drive. The engine rev'd higher and then the trans "caught". Drove home with no issues, maybe 5 miles. Later that day my wife drove it and it started experiencing the missing D and OD. So did the restart while moving cause this, and is it something that might be semi-easily fixed, or does this sound like a rebuild? Explorer has 150k and there are no codes.
